Burgers On Grill Time Per Side. For beef burgers, use a meat thermometer to check the internal temperature and determine the cooking time: Burger grill time chart for fresh hamburgers. For a medium burger, cook for 3 to 3 1/2 minutes per side for 6 to 7. In general, it’s recommended to cook a burger on the grill for between 2 to 6 minutes per side, depending on how well done you want your burger. Grill times vary based on doneness levels, such as rare or well done, but there are standard suggestions across the board to help you know an approximate cook time. The thicker the burger, the more time you'll need. How long you should keep your burger on the grill depends on the thickness of the patty and the desired doneness. Best tools to use when.
